This bulletin replaces Technical Bulletin, Group 1, Number 8802, dated March 11, 1988. This bulletin contains the latest part number for the oil cooler
O-ring seals and instructions for testing the oil cooler for leaks.
FIGURE 1
New Oil Cooler O-Rings
The sealing O-rings (A, figure 1) located on the oil cooler of normally aspirated cars and on the connecting pipe of the oil thermostat housing of Turbo
cars, have been changed. The new version O-ring is now green in color (formerly red). When repairing, use ONLY the new version green O-rings. Part
Number 999 707 043 40.
The new version O-rings are installed from the following engine numbers.
46 J 06772
924S, 944 Manual trans.
46 J 61599
924S, 944 Auto trans.
42 J 01420
944S
45 J 01753
944 Turbo
47 J 00899
944 Turbo S
Pressure Testing Oil Cooler (normally aspirated cars only)
To test the oil cooler for leaks proceed as follows:
Obtain the following parts:
1 - Hose clamp - 16-25 mm 1 - Dust cap - 23 mm diameter A water container large enough to completely submerge the oil cooler.
